Why Politicians Can’t Ban Video Games?

Law, Political game, Political Play, Politics, Technology

Video game downloads are frequently in the news for all the wrong reasons, with politicians blaming them for encouraging violence, promoting antisocial behavior, and even causing school shootings. As a result, several countries have tried to introduce laws that restrict how and when people can play video games.

People always Find a Way to Play Games they want

We’ve seen that many of the games that politicians have tried to ban are extremely popular. People who really want to play them will always find a way — often through illegal means.

If certain games suddenly become illegal to buy or play, the people who want to play them will find a way to do it. The only difference is that video games are digital, so people can play them online on servers located in different countries. This creates extra layer of difficulty for a government to stop people from playing what they want — even if it means breaking the law.

Video Games are Too Big of a Business to be Banned

The global video games industry is worth around $100 billion a year. In fact, in the US alone, it employs more than a million people, many of whom earn a living wage.

A lot of these people are employed in the fields of game development, publishing, and marketing.

If video games were suddenly banned, it would cost the economy billions of dollars and cost many people their jobs. In fact, we’ve seen that these types of bans often lead to the rise of an illegal black market, which is controlled by criminals who don’t care about the law.

Politicians and law enforcement find it very hard to shut down black markets, as they operate out of sight from the authorities and are hard to track down.

Banning Video Games would be Impossible to Enforce

Even if a government managed to ban a video game, how would they enforce it? There’s no way to know how many copies of a game were sold or downloaded illegally, or how many people playing a game online are in a country that has banned it.

Do Video Games like RAID affect Teen’s Viewpoint in Politics?

Political game, Politics

Even in our modern time, there’s so little that we know about how video games are influencing the civic engagement of the youth. There haven’t been a lot of studies available whether civic development is backed by civic gaming experience as working with others cooperatively, creating a virtual nation, expanding social network online or even help the less seasoned players to get around the game.

While the latter is possible by reading guides such as RAID guide and tutorials (if you’re into it), still it requires thorough studies to support any arguments. Though the connection between these civic activities in other civic outcomes as well as domains has been studied.

Studies Showing the Youth’s Political Point-of-View

Experts in the subject of civic education have performed quasi-experimental and longitudinal studies that checks the connection between social contexts and school-based civic learning opportunities and the political and civic engagement of younger people. In the research, the contexts and opportunities that are discovered to be effective include the following:

  1. Learning how political, governmental and legal systems work
  2. Learning about social issues
  3. Taking part in simulations of both political and civic activities
  4. Volunteering to help others and;
  5. Taking part in extracurricular activities in which young people could expand their social networks and practice productive group norms

When such experiences are handed out to young people both in school and in an after-school setting, especially to adolescents who are at their critical age of development for civic identity, the research discovered that it boosts their commitment to political and civic participation.

Video Games and its Impact

The continuous growth and popularity of video games especially among teens raises some eyebrows whether it can deliver the same opportunities for political and civic engagement with similar results. In this regard, the civic gaming experiences measured include:

  • Guiding or helping other players
  • Playing video games in which one knows about a challenge or problem in the society
  • Playing games that are exploring social issue that the player cares about
  • Playing games wherein players need to think of their ethical or moral issues
  • Playing games where players can help in making decisions on how the community, the city or the nation as a whole must be run and;
  • Organizing guilds or game groups

Office politics

Office politics is something that almost everyone has to deal with: gossip and backbiting, slander and career sabotage, slime and heel-licking. Although office politics has a negative connotation, it can also be used in a positive and conscious manner to advance your career without harming others.

Mates and coworkers will always tell you, “I don’t do office politics; I don’t need it.” That’s nonsense; everybody sometimes speaks about a colleague who isn’t around, or inquires of the secretary as to why the director was so irritable.

Another famous but naïve assertion is, “Value will emerge by itself.” . To get things done, you have to play the workplace politics game to some degree.

Everything is political

Any company participates in political game. Each person pursues his or her own interests and is willing to inflict some harm on others in order to achieve his or her objectives. Office politics is a fight over finite capital in which one’s advantage is always at the cost of another’s. In economically difficult times, nefarious office politics can be especially effective.
